Explanation
Please explain in the area below why an STA is necessary:
Pursuant to Section 5.61 of the Commission’s rules, Joby Aero, Inc. (“Joby”) hereby requests Special Temporary Authority (“STA”) to operate a new conventional experimental radio service station (flight test telemetry and/or video) for a period of 180 days. See Exhibit A

Purpose of Operation
Please explain the purpose of operation:  Joby develops and manufactures major aircraft components. Joby requests STA in order to test and evaluate the performance characteristics of aircraft radio equipment manufactured by Advanced Microwave Products (Model# VST1) in the 5137 - 5150 MHz band. Aircraft using the equipment will operate during daylight hours, any day of the week. Flight tests typically will be one hour in duration and will utilize the frequencies in the areas specified in the foregoing Form up to a maximum altitude of 15,000 feet above mean sea level. Test equipment will be operated only in one aircraft at a time for each location, though multiple aircraft may operate the equipment on any given day. See Exhibit A
